Lucky, all my gifts are wrapped so today I can proudly present my musical wrapping. Now this really has my heart singing. After a fossick through the books at Savers Footscray, I came across an old book of sheet music with pages yellowed just so without signs of mildew. After forking out $1.99 for the book, I was bursting to try this wrapping I'd only previously seen in magazines. Quick trip to a discount variety store for some red ribbon, a shipping label, some stamping with my kikki.k set and voila. Sweet tunes all round.

A few tips: some gifts are too big to wrap in the pages of the music book but it looked great on a solid square or rectangle (as above). Also, old books can smell musty. I posted two gifts wrapped this way interstate and was worried that they might not smell great after being trapped in a post bag, so just to be sure, I gave the gifts a spray of parfum! For this reason, this wrapping may not be for everyone. Keep some cartoon Santa wrapping paper on hand for those that may not appreciate your creative, gorgeous masterpieces (and for the kiddies that just want to rip into the treasure without a bow in their path). Save the delightful, vintage-inspired creations pour moi!
